# Google account missing Last updated: July 24, 2026 ## Problem End user is trying to enroll a mobile device and he gets the error message "Google account missing". ## Cause Users might see this error message when they have not provided their Google account on the mobile device. The Android device being enrolled needs to have the user's Google account information added to it. If the user has not provided the Google account information, enrollment will fail. ## Resolution In such cases, users are notified to log in to their Google account to continue the enrollment process. If the end user is unaware of the process, instruct them to navigate to the following location and provide their account information: **Settings > Account & Sync > Add Account**, then retry the enrollment process. **Applies to:** Profile Management, Device Enrollment **Keywords:** Google Account missing, Enrollment failure, Android Agent installation
